Understanding Cold Storage: A Safe Haven for Your Crypto
Imagine your digital assets as physical cash. Just as you wouldn’t leave your money exposed in your home, the same principle applies to cryptocurrencies. Cold storage acts like a bank vault for digital assets. Let’s dive into the characteristics and types of cold storage solutions.
- Hardware Wallets: These include devices like Ledger Nano X and Trezor, which are designed to store your private keys offline, minimizing exposure to online threats.
- Paper Wallets: A more old-school method involves generating a public and private key and writing it down physically. While this is secure, it comes with the risk of physical damage.
- Air-gapped Computers: This type of storage involves using a dedicated computer that is never connected to the internet, thus isolating your cryptocurrency assets from online vulnerabilities.

Comparative Analysis: Cold vs. Hot Storage Solutions
Understanding the difference between cold and hot storage is essential for any crypto investor. In a nutshell, cold storage is offline, while hot storage represents online wallets. Here’s a brief comparison:
| Aspect | Cold Storage | Hot Storage |
|---|---|---|
| Security | Highly secure against online threats | Vulnerable to hacks |
| Accessibility | Less convenient for transactions | Easy and fast transactions |
| Ideal for | Long-term storage and large amounts | Frequent traders and small amounts |
Implementing Cold Storage Practices in Vietnam
For effective cold storage in Vietnam, here’s how individuals and businesses can navigate their protection strategies:
- Choose Reputable Hardware: Choosing the right hardware wallet is crucial. Renowned brands such as Ledger and Trezor have gained user trust through robust security protocols.
- Create Multiple Backups: Ensuring that you have multiple backups of your keys in various locations can prevent catastrophic losses.
